Recognizing Various Kinds of Drywall



Understanding the various kinds of drywall is essential for any successful fixing or installment task. Drywall, typically known as gypsum board, is available in numerous varieties customized for details applications. Requirement drywall is one of the most commonly made use of kind, ideal for basic interior walls and ceilings. Moisture-resistant drywall, usually green in shade, is developed for locations vulnerable to moisture, such as cooking areas and shower rooms. Fireproof drywall, typically colored pink or purple, is engineered to endure greater temperatures and is frequently used in garages or near furnaces. In addition, soundproof drywall aids lower noise transmission, making it appropriate for multi-family homes or tape-recording workshops. Specialty drywall, like concrete board, is made use of in wet areas like showers or bathtub borders. Comprehending these kinds aids in choosing the appropriate material for each and every job, making sure sturdiness and effectiveness out of commission or brand-new installments.

Repair Refine Actions



Fixing openings and splits in drywall requires a methodical method to guarantee a smooth coating. The area surrounding the damage ought to be cleaned extensively to get rid of dust and debris. Next off, for small cracks, a putty blade is made use of to use a joint substance equally over the area. For bigger holes, a spot is essential; the damaged area is eliminated, and a new item of drywall is suited location, safeguarded with screws. When the patch remains in setting, joint substance is related to mix the sides. After drying out, fining sand the location smooth is necessary. Ultimately, the fixed surface area should be keyed and repainted to match the surrounding wall, ensuring an inconspicuous fixing.


Techniques for Installing Drywall Panels



Mounting drywall panels needs mindful planning and accurate execution to ensure a expert and smooth surface. Initially, it is vital to determine the wall area accurately and cut the panels to fit, ensuring that they align with the studs. Positioning the panels horizontally is commonly recommended, as this can enhance the structural honesty and decrease the variety of joints.


Making use of drywall screws, installers need to safeguard the panels every 16 inches along the studs, making sure a company hold. It is important to avoid overdriving the screws, which can damage the paper surface. For edges and corners, using an energy blade permits clean cuts and a snug fit.

Completing Touches: Taping, Mudding, and Fining sand



As soon as the drywall panels are firmly in position, the next essential step involves the complements of taping, mudding, and sanding. Taping is very important for producing a seamless shift between panels and hiding joints. A top quality drywall tape, either paper or fiberglass harmonize, ought to be applied over the joints, ensuring it adheres effectively to the mud that will be applied sites following.


Mudding, or using joint compound, follows the taping process. This substance loads gaps and smooths out the surface. A very first coat should be applied kindly, feathering the edges to mix with the drywall. After the initial coat dries, succeeding layers may be required for a flawless coating.


Fining sand is required to attain a smooth surface area. A fine-grit sandpaper needs to be utilized to gently smooth out any type of imperfections. Tips for Maintaining Your Drywall After Installment



Maintaining drywall after installment is essential to protecting its appearance and architectural stability. Regular cleaning is essential; dust and dirt can collect, so mild wiping with a moist fabric is advised. Home owners ought to likewise inspect for any indications of wetness or mold, specifically in high-humidity locations like shower rooms and kitchen areas. If any damage occurs, it is essential to address it promptly to avoid further problems.


Using furniture pads can help avoid scrapes or damages from heavy items. Additionally, repainting the drywall with a premium, washable paint provides an extra layer of defense and makes future cleansing easier. Prevent utilizing unpleasant cleaners or tools, as these can harm the surface. Keeping a steady indoor climate with ideal humidity levels will aid prevent contorting or cracking over time. By complying with these tips, one can guarantee that drywall stays in excellent condition for years to come.

Exactly how Do I Choose the Right Drywall Density?



To pick the best drywall thickness, consider the application and place. Standard property walls generally utilize 1/2 inch, while ceilings or specialized locations may call for 5/8 inch for additional toughness and soundproofing capabilities.
